FORT LAUDERDALE-HOLLYWOOD INTERNATIONAL AIRPORT, FLA. (WSVN) - Authorities said they have located a man days after he went missing from Fort Lauderdale-Hollywood International Airport.

According to the Broward Sheriff’s Office Missing Persons Unit, 44-year-old Syed Raza Ali-Khan, had been last seen at around 10:30 a.m. on Tuesday, Jan. 16, near 50 Terminal Drive at FLL.

Ali-Khan was described as weighing approximately 150 pounds, standing 5 feet, 9 inches tall, with black hair and brown eyes.

At the time of his disappearance, he had been wearing dark jeans, a long-sleeve gray shirt, a black jacket and gray sneakers with red laces.

Sunday afternoon, BSO detectives confirmed Ali-Khan was found safe and unharmed.
